Two Vols earn SEC weekly honors after Arkansas win
Two Tennessee football players were honored when the SEC announced its weekly awards Monday. Kicker Max Gilbert was named SEC Co-Special Teams Player of the Week, while wide receiver Braylon Staley earned Freshman of the Week by the conference after the Vols defeated Arkansas, 34-31, at Neyland Stadium.

SEC reveals start time, TV channel for Auburn vs. Arkansas in Week 9
The SEC announced the start times and TV network assignments for Week 9's action on Monday, including Auburn football's game at Arkansas. The Tigers and Razorbacks will square off at 11:45 a.m. CT on Saturday, Oct. 25, at Reynolds Razorback Stadium in Fayetteville, Arkansas. The game will be broadcast on SEC Network.

SEC’s Greg Sankey rejects pooling conference TV rights as a solution to problems in college sports
A bill in Congress co-sponsored by Sen. Maria Cantwell, D-Wash., calls for a rewrite of the 1961 Sports Broadcasting Act, which forbids the conferences from combining their TV rights. Campbell supports that element of Cantwell’s recently introduced SAFE Act.
